When you look at MCA financing, the price isn't a flat fee. It usually depends on your company's daily transaction volume, your industry type, and how long you have been operating. Lenders check your cash flow to gauge risk, which directly influences the factor rate applied to your advance. If your business has steady, high-volume deposits, you might see better terms. Conversely, businesses with fluctuating sales or shorter track records might see higher rates to offset the lender's risk. A merchant cash advance (MCA) provides a business with a lump sum of cash in exchange for a percentage of its future credit and debit card sales. This is a flexible funding option that is repaid automatically through daily sales deductions. MCA stands for Merchant Cash Advance. It's a business funding method where a company receives an upfront cash payment in exchange for a portion of its future credit card sales, plus a fee.
